‘2 YRS, ZERO DEVELOPMENT’: KTR SLAMS CONG GOVT IN KHAMMAM

Khammam, Jan.7 (RAHNUMA): BRS working president K.T. Rama Rao on Wednesday accused the Congress government of failing to deliver any development in Khammam district even after two years in power. Despite having three ministers from the district, the people had seen ‘no tangible benefits’, he remarked.

Addressing a felicitation meeting of the newly elected BRS sarpanches in Khammam, KTR recalled that former Chief Minister K. Chandrashekar Rao had initiated the Sitarama Sagar project to transform the district, completing nearly 90 percent of the works. He said the project was designed to provide irrigation to 7.5 lakh acres and secure Khammam’s rightful share of Godavari waters.

KTR alleged that the Congress government had neglected and sidelined the project. He accused the three district ministers of prioritising commissions over public welfare, claiming they were ‘incapable of doing good’ and were deceiving the people. Sitarama Sagar project was planned to irrigate 1.30 lakh acres in Aswaraopet, along with benefits to Sathupalli (40,000 acres), Illendu (20,000 acres), Kothagudem (10,000 acres) and Wyra (20,000 acres), but was abandoned by the present government, he quipped.

Mocking the Congress leadership, KTR said that apart from ‘defaults, demolitions and explosions’, the state government had achieved nothing in the last two years.
